Understanding the distinction between kilowatts (kW) and watts (W) can be confusing for many. Essentially, a kilowatt is simply a bigger unit of measurement for power . One kilowatt represents 1,000 watts. Therefore, to transform kilowatts to watts, you easily multiply the kilowatt amount by 1,000. For example , if you have 2.5 kilowatts, that’s equal to 2,500 watts. This straightforward method is widely used when calculating electrical consumption or appliance ratings.
Watts to kW : Easy Conversions Explained
Understanding the difference between watts and kilowatts can feel complicated, but it's actually quite straightforward to determine. One unit is equal to 1000 watts – so, to convert watts to kilowatts, you simply separate the wattage amount by 1000. For example , a 2000-watt item uses 2 kW of power. This fundamental calculation is important for understanding your energy costs and picking the appropriate sized appliances for your residence .

Grasping Electrical Shifts: Power , Kilowatts & Amps
Comprehending the world of electrical systems can feel intimidating , especially when you come across concepts like watts, kilowatts, and amps. Essentially , watts measure the rate of energy usage , kilowatts represent 1,000 watts, and amps indicate the quantity of electrical current . Familiarizing yourself with these relationships is essential for everything from estimating your energy bill to verifying the correct functioning of your electronics.
